Spain - Healthcare Expenditure on Preventive Care by Government Schemes and Compulsory Contributory Health Care Financing Schemes

Since 2014, Spain Healthcare Expenditure on Preventive Care by Government Schemes and Compulsory Contributory Health Care Financing Schemes jumped by 3%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 16 comparing other countries in Healthcare Expenditure on Preventive Care by Government Schemes and Compulsory Contributory Health Care Financing Schemes with €48.45 Per Capita. Spain is overtaken by Liechtenstein, which was ranked number 15 with €51.77 Per Capita and is followed by France with €46.93 Per Capita. Sweden topped the ranking with €144.4 Per Capita in 2019, that is +3% compared to 2018. Norway, Iceland and United Kingdom resp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Latvia witnessed the best average annual growth at +13.6% per year, while Slovakia witnessed the worst performance at -16.1% per year.
